The effects of plant density, number and stages of weed control in corn (Zea mays L.) Varieties on seed yield and weeds dry matter in Kerman

Abstract:
In order to evaluate the effects of plant density, number and stages of weed control, on weeds dry matter and seed yield of corn varieties, an experiment was conducted in 2011 on research farm, College of Agric. Univ. of Shahid Bahonar, Kerman, Iran. It was in randomized complete block (RCBD) in factorial design, with 3 replications. Weed control treatments were W1: weed control 4 times (2, 4, 6 and 8 weeks after planting), W2: weed control 3 times (2, 4 and 8 weeks after planting), W3: weed control 2 times (4 and 8 after weeks after planting) and W4: no weed control during corn growth season. Corn varieties were Single cross 704 and Maxima from FAO580, and were planted under 70,000 and 90,000 plants in hectare densities. Corn seed yield, plant leaves area, leaves dry matter, steam dry matter, total plant dry matter and weeds dry matter were calculated. The results showed that W4 treatment showed significant different in seed yield reduction compared to other weed control treatments. W1, W2 and W3 showed no significant difference between each others, so it can be concluded that W3 treatment could be used as an effective and economic weed control treatment in Kerman. Increasing weed-crop interaction time, caused low plant leaves, leaf and stem dry matter, and total plant dry matter of corn. Higher corn density produced lower total dry matter, leaf and stem dry matter and weeds dry matter. Seed yield increased with higher density. Maxima variety had higher seed yield and plant leaves area than Single cross 704. It seems that higher density caused a better ability and weed competition, and produced higher seed yield.
